Causeway Coast and Glens Council will open community assistance centre hubs in both Coleraine Leisure Centre and Roe Valley Leisure Centre this weekend to help anyone affected by Storm Éowyn.

The hubs will be open during normal weekend opening times of:

Saturday 25th January: 8:15am – 3:30pm

Sunday 26th January: 10:00am – 3:30pm

"As we continue to assess storm damage to council buildings, we will advise on additional community assistance centre hub locations in due course to support those residents who have been most affected by the storm," said a council spokesperson.

"These facilities will enable residents who have been impacted by power cuts to charge mobile devices, keep warm and to also get a hot cup of tea or coffee.

"We would ask that you share this information with friends, family and neighbours who do not have internet access.

"Please continue to exercise caution when travelling while Met Office weather warnings remain in place."
